ARIA `tooltip`-Elemente haben zugängliche Namen
Der ARIA (Accessible Rich Internet Applications)-Elementtyp tooltip
ist ein wichtiger Aspekt der Barrierefreiheit im Web, da es Benutzern mit Behinderungen ermöglicht, auf Informationen zuzugreifen, die möglicherweise nicht sofort auf der Seite sichtbar sind. Damit ein tooltip
wirklich barrierefrei ist, muss er über einen barrierefreien Namen verfügen.
Ein barrierefreier Name ist eine Information, die programmgesteuert ermittelt werden kann und Benutzern mit Hilfe von Assistive Technologies, wie Screen-Readern, mitgeteilt wird. Dies stellt sicher, dass Benutzer mit Behinderungen die Inhalte einer Webseite verstehen und damit interagieren können.
Die Bedeutung barrierefreier Namen für tooltip
-Elemente kann nicht genug betont werden. Ohne einen barrierefreien Namen können Benutzer mit Behinderungen möglicherweise die Informationen im tooltip
nicht abrufen, was zu einer frustrierenden und verwirrenden Benutzererfahrung führen kann. In manchen Fällen kann dies sogar verhindern, dass Benutzer Aufgaben auf der Webseite abschließen.
Um sicherzustellen, dass ein tooltip
-Element über einen barrierefreien Namen verfügt, sollten Entwickler das Attribut aria-label
verwenden. Dieses Attribut ermöglicht es Entwicklern, eine Textzeichenfolge anzugeben, die als barrierefreier Name für den tooltip
verwendet wird. Es ist wichtig, bei der Angabe des aria-label
klare und prägnante Sprache zu verwenden, um sicherzustellen, dass Benutzer mit Behinderungen den Inhalt des tooltip
verstehen können.
Zusätzlich zur Verwendung des Attributs aria-label
sollten Entwickler auch das Attribut title
in Betracht ziehen, um einen barrierefreien Namen für den tooltip
zu bereitstellen. Das Attribut title
ist ein standardmäßiges HTML-Attribut, das häufig verwendet wird, um zusätzliche Informationen über ein Element bereitzustellen. Wenn es in Verbindung mit dem Attribut aria-label
verwendet wird, kann das Attribut title
eine zusätzliche Barrierefreiheitsebene für Benutzer mit Behinderungen bieten.
Zusammenfassend ist die Bedeutung barrierefreier Namen für ARIA-`tooltip`
-Elemente nicht zu unterschätzen. Durch die Verwendung des Attributs aria-labelund des Attributs
titlekönnen Entwickler sicherstellen, dass Benutzer mit Behinderungen auf die im
tooltip` enthaltenen Informationen zugreifen und diese verstehen können. Dies ist von entscheidender Bedeutung für eine wirklich barrierefreie und benutzerfreundliche Web-Erfahrung.
Ähnliche Artikel:
Kein Formularfeld hat mehrere Labels `[aria-hidden="true"]` ist in dem Dokument `<body>` nicht vorhanden `[role]`-Elemente sind ihren jeweils erforderlichen übergeordneten Elementen untergeordnet `[id]`-Attribute zu aktiven, fokussierbaren Elementen sind eindeutig `[role]`-Elemente verfügen über alle erforderlichen `[aria-*]`-Attribute Formularelemente sind mit Labels verknüpft `[user-scalable="no"]` wird nicht im `<meta name="viewport">`-Element verwendet und das `[maximum-scale]`-Attribut ist nicht kleiner als 5. `[aria-hidden="true"]`-Elemente enthalten keine fokussierbaren Unterelemente Dieses Dokument verwendet `<meta http-equiv="refresh">` nicht Zellen in einem "`<table>`"-Element, die das Attribut "`[headers]`" enthalten, verweisen auf Zellen in derselben Tabelle.